The DVSA is building a dedicated Enterprise Architecture (EA) team to act as the bridge between the business and digital and data delivery. The Chief Enterprise Architect leads a team of Enterprise, Technical and Solution Architects to deliver a strategically aligned architecture service, to deliver great customer outcomes and demonstrate business value. They will contribute to the development and delivery of new and evolving operating models, accountable for delivering enterprise-wide architecture capability to ensure the best and most cost-effective technology solutions are developed and deployed for DVSA’s services.

Operating effectively with multi-disciplinary teams of Digital & Data professionals, policy experts and service teams throughout the change lifecycle, the Chief Enterprise Architect will use business architecture to inform shape and define strategic business design. They will support design, building and delivering to meet user needs, understand business goals and be able to translate future needs into statements of capability.

Job description

  • Provide technical leadership in the development, operation, and continual improvement of complex, transformational digital services serving millions of users.
  • Direct the development of enterprise-wide business design and information architecture, embedding the strategic application of technology into DVSA’s organisational management.
  • Develop and communicate the organisation’s enterprise architecture strategy, ensuring robust governance, audit, control, and compliance across DVSA’s technology landscape.
  • Lead the development of architectures for complex systems, ensuring quality, documentation, and alignment with both internal and external customer requirements.
  • Oversee work delivered by external partners to ensure DVSA’s reference architecture is robust, scalable, open, secure, and delivers a high-quality user experience through effective system design and API integration.
  • Champion and manage an evolutionary architecture approach, communicating architectural direction across the Department for Transport family and wider government.

Person specification

  • A strong track record in providing hands-on, pragmatic architectural leadership across a geographically dispersed, multi-service, and technologically diverse environment—working with both internal teams and external service providers.
  • Considerable experience in developing and defining strategic target business architecture to support improved organisational outcomes, strategic decision-making, architectural governance, and optimal business design.
  • An excellent applied knowledge of modern technical architectures, cloud technology, IT infrastructure, data management, and software development lifecycle management—ideally with experience in enterprise systems such as CRM, compliance, and automation platforms.
  • Considerable experience of driving and delivering technological change at pace within a context of organisational transformation, operating across functional and organisational boundaries with shifting priorities.
  • Demonstrable experience in developing technical capability within an organisation, including empowering, supporting, and developing staff to achieve high performance.
  • Strong relationship-building, influencing, and negotiation skills to provide effective technical and professional leadership to the wider architecture and technology community.

Qualifications

You will need either:

  • A degree level qualification in a Digital Development and Technology discipline; OR
  • A formal architectural qualification in either BCS, The Open Group Architecture Framework (TOGAF), Zachman, Gartner’s Enterprise Architecture Method; OR
  • A formal cloud architecture qualification either Microsoft Azure Solution Architect Expert and/or AWS Solution Architect Associate; OR
  • A formal architecture modelling qualification in either Archimate, UML (Unified Modelling Language) or BPMN (Business Process Model and Notation); OR
  • Be able to demonstrate relevant experience at an equivalent level to the above.
